#976359 Hex Color Code

#976359

The Hexadecimal Color #976359 is a contrast shade of Sienna. #976359 RGB value is rgb(151, 99, 89). RGB Color Model of #976359 consists of 59% red, 38% green and 34% blue. HSL color Mode of #976359 has 10°(degrees) Hue, 26% Saturation and 47% Lightness. #976359 color has an wavelength of 613.7037n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#976359 is #996666.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#976359 is #965. The Closest Color to #976359 is #A0522D. Official Name of #976359 Hex Code is Au Chico.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#976359 is 0 Cyan 34 Magenta 41 Yellow 41 Black and #976359 CMY is 0, 34, 41.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#976359 is hsl(10,26,47,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(10, 41, 59).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#976359 is 19.03, 16.23, 11.58.
Hex8 Value of #976359 is #976359FF. Decimal Value of #976359 is 9921369 and Octal Value of #976359 is 45661531. Binary Value of #976359 is 10010111, 1100011, 1011001 and Android of #976359 is 4288111449 / 0xff976359.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#976359 is 0.406, 0.346, 0.346 and YIQ Color Space of #976359 is 113.408, 34.1998, 7.886.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#976359 is 19.04, 14.23, 11.67.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#976359 is 47.27, 19.77, 14.34.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#976359 is 47.27, 35.81, 14.2.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#976359 is 47.27, 24.42, 35.95. Hunter Lab variable of #976359 is 40.29, 13.82, 11.16.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#976359

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
